I used to use newspapers about 1/2 inch thick and spread in the corner (3ft x 2ft approx) and then I would place 2 or 3 wee wee pads on top. Then I was finding that Roxy and TJ would tear the ends of the newspaper and drag the wee wee pads all over the room. So, I decided to do away with the newspaper (fear of them eating it) and only leave the 3 wee wee pads in a row in the corner. Then I came home one day to a mess and torn up wee wee pads. TJ pooped some blue plastic a few times after that day. So, I order the piddle pads. I thought they would be great but I had to ancor them down with weight so they would play and drag them around. They worked for a day b/c the pee really wouldn't dry up, it just spread and they refused to keep peeing ontop of the wet pad (I am at work all day so I couldn't change the piddle pads once the whole top was wet), so they decided to just pee and poop ALL OVER THE FLOOR! Now, what I have done is I got one of the medium sized Dog Litter Box and I put a wee wee pad inside (I had to fold the blue plastic pieces under) and I also laid one wee wee pad next to it (also with the blue plastic folded under), but the one side is butted up to the wall and the 2 sides are held down by the litter box and a weighted down little bucket. So far no one has attempted to drag and/or eat the pads in this set up. |
